Visiting the Isabella Blow exhibition – Interns Berna & Anna

March 5, 2014 / 0 Comments

Two of our interns took the chance to visit The Isabella Blow exhibition at Somerset House last week.  They wanted to share their day and write about how amazing the exhibition was.

‘Yesterday we had the chance to visit the fashion exhibition” Isabella Blow: Fashion Galore!” at Somerset House. The exhibition is presented by the Isabella Blow Foundation and Central Saint Martins celebrating her extraordinary and unique wardrobe. Isabella was known for her eye-catching and artistic way to style. This is the main focus of the exhibition, which presents over a hundred pieces from her incredible and eccentric collection.

It is dominated by pieces from her most favoured designers such as Alexander McQueen, Manolo Blahnik and Philip Treacy.

Philip Treacy’s creative hat designs were especially fascinating. They come in every colour and form that a human can imagine. The best example for that is perhaps “Marilyn’s lips” hat .

It reminds us of Isabella Blow’s love for red lips. Even her letters and business cards are signed with a deep red kiss.

The exhibition ends with an amazing and extravagant fashion show of Alexander McQueen and Philip Treacy.

Through our trip to Somerset House we came to the conclusion that clothes, no matter how special and unusual they are, should be worn.’
